I've done a bit of research in this area, and it really doesn't matter what state the textiles are in - as long as they are not wet or mouldy.
According to a London recycler, http://www.lmb.co.uk/recycle.html, torn and stained textiles get turned into things like cleaning rags, I've also read somewhere that they get turned into mattress filling and car insulation, all sorts!
Anyway hope that helps anyone else who stumbles on this... Ultimately all these organisations want to avoid the textiles going into a landfill site.
